A LITTLE MORE CONTEXTAbout This Letter X Coloring Page
Use this page as a short letter-recognition invitation. Start by naming a xylophone and pointing to X; then compare the uppercase and lowercase forms before choosing colors. The scene includes the different bar lengths and mallets, giving a child something concrete to describe instead of turning the page into a vocabulary test.
